Installation & Care
Installation Requirements
- Suitable for interior wall applications only—not recommended for floors
- Ensure walls are clean, dry, flat, and properly prepared before installation
- Use high-quality porcelain tile adhesive for secure bonding
- Maintain consistent 2-3mm grout joints for professional results
- Consider using tile spacers and levelling clips for perfect alignment
- Both smooth and pleated options install using standard tiling techniques
- Can be cut with standard tile cutters or wet saws
Pattern Planning Start with a centred tile or centred grout line depending on wall width. For brick bond pattern, ensure 50% offset between rows. Plan cuts carefully around windows, outlets, and fixtures. Consider ordering tiles from the same batch for consistent colour.
Easy Maintenance
Porcelain metro tiles are remarkably low-maintenance. Daily cleaning requires just a damp microfibre cloth. For deeper cleaning, use pH-neutral tile cleaners. The non-porous surface resists staining, making these tiles perfect for high-use areas. Pleated tiles may require occasional brushing along the ridges to prevent dust accumulation. Re-seal grout annually to maintain water resistance and appearance.
Frequently Asked Questions
How many tiles do I need per square metre?
You'll need approximately 67 tiles per square metre for standard brick bond pattern, accounting for 3mm grout joints. For other patterns like herringbone, add 15% extra. We recommend ordering 10% additional for standard installations to cover cuts, breakages, and future repairs.
Can I mix smooth and pleated tiles?
Absolutely! Many customers create stunning feature strips or zones by combining both finishes. Use pleated tiles as a decorative border, create horizontal bands, or designate entire walls for textural contrast. Both finishes share identical dimensions and colour for seamless integration.
What's the best grout colour for off-white tiles?
This depends on your desired look. White grout creates a seamless appearance perfect for small spaces. Grey grout (light or dark) adds definition and hides everyday dirt better. For dramatic impact, black grout creates a striking grid pattern. Request our grout colour chart to see all options.
Are these tiles suitable for shower walls?
Yes! The porcelain construction makes them completely waterproof and ideal for shower enclosures. Ensure proper waterproof backing and use epoxy or waterproof grout in shower areas. The smooth finish is easier to clean in showers, though pleated tiles can be used for accent walls outside direct water zones.
How do I clean grout lines?
Regular cleaning prevents grout discolouration. Use a soft brush with bicarbonate of soda paste for routine cleaning. For tougher stains, apply specialised grout cleaner following manufacturer instructions. Avoid harsh acids or bleach that can damage grout. Annual resealing keeps grout looking fresh.
Can these be installed over existing tiles?
While possible with proper preparation and adhesive, we recommend removing old tiles for best results. If tiling over existing tiles, ensure they're firmly attached, thoroughly clean, and use appropriate primer and adhesive designed for tile-on-tile application.
